In Moscow, at the Megasport stadium, the next match of the Fonbet championship of the Kontinental Hockey League of the 2023/2024 season ended, in which the local team Spartak hosted SKA St. Petersburg. The match ended with a victory for the hosts with a score of 3:2 (1:1, 0:0, 2:1).

In the eighth minute, Marat Khairullin gave SKA the lead. Mikhail Vorobyov and Sergei Tolchinsky received points for their assists. In the 12th minute, Pavel Poryadin equalized the score. In the 45th minute, Alexander Kadeikin gave SKA the lead again. Mikhail Pashnin and Alex Galchenyuk received points for their assists. In the 51st minute, Pavel Poryadin restored the tie with a pass from Nikolai Goldobin – 2:2. A second before the end of the third period, Alexander Belyaev scored the decisive goal.
